Can I take a dog to Sheremetyevo Airport? - briefly
Yes, you can take a dog to Sheremetyevo Airport. However, it is essential to adhere to the airport's regulations and guidelines for traveling with pets.
Sheremetyevo Airport allows passengers to bring pets, but there are specific rules to follow. Pets must be transported in approved carriers that meet the airline's size and weight requirements. It is crucial to check with your airline for detailed information, as policies may vary. Additionally, ensure that all necessary documentation, such as health certificates and vaccination records, are up-to-date and readily available. Passengers should also be aware of the designated pet relief areas within the airport for the comfort and convenience of their animals.
Can I take a dog to Sheremetyevo Airport? - in detail
Taking a dog to Sheremetyevo Airport, one of the busiest and most modern airports in Russia, is permissible under certain conditions. The airport has specific regulations and guidelines in place to ensure the safety and comfort of both passengers and their pets. It is essential to be well-prepared and informed before traveling with a dog to avoid any inconveniences or delays.
Firstly, it is crucial to understand that Sheremetyevo Airport allows pets in designated areas. Pets are generally not permitted in the sterile areas of the airport, which include the security checkpoints, boarding gates, and aircraft cabins, unless they are service animals or traveling in the cargo hold. Passengers traveling with pets should be aware of the airline's policies, as each airline has its own set of rules regarding pet travel. Some airlines may allow small pets in the cabin, provided they are in an approved carrier and meet specific size and weight restrictions. Larger pets typically travel in the cargo hold, and it is essential to ensure that the airline's cargo services are available for the specific route.
Before arriving at the airport, it is advisable to contact the airline and the airport authorities to confirm the regulations and requirements for traveling with a pet. Some airlines may require a health certificate issued by a veterinarian, proof of vaccinations, and a valid pet passport. Additionally, it is essential to arrive at the airport with sufficient time to complete the necessary procedures, as traveling with a pet may involve additional steps and documentation.
Upon arrival at Sheremetyevo Airport, passengers with pets should proceed to the designated pet check-in area. This area is usually located near the check-in counters, and airport staff can provide assistance and guidance. It is important to have all the required documentation readily available, including the pet's health certificate, vaccination records, and any other relevant paperwork. Passengers should also ensure that their pet is comfortably secured in an approved carrier or on a leash, depending on the airline's regulations.
During the journey, it is essential to follow the airline's guidelines for pet care. This may include providing food and water at specific intervals, ensuring the pet's comfort, and adhering to any restrictions on pet movement within the aircraft. Upon arrival at the destination, passengers should follow the local regulations and guidelines for pet entry, which may include additional health checks and documentation.
